Weight Watchers Baby Twice-Baked Potatoes Recipe

Ingredients:

8 small red potatoes (about 1 pound),
2 green onions-finely chopped,
1/3 c. reduced-fat sour cream,
1/3 c. skim milk,
2 slices bacon-cooked & crumbled,
1/2 c. shredded reduced-fat sharp Cheddar cheese,
1/8 tsp. garlic powder,
1/2 tsp. salt,
1/8 tsp. pepper

Directions:

Preheat oven to 350º. Wash & pierce potatoes with a fork. Place on paper towel in microwave & cook on high 6 min. or til tender. Let stand 5 minutes. Cut each potato in half & scoop out the cooked potato, saving the potato skin shell. Mix cooked potato, onions & remaining ingredients with an electric mixer. Spoon mixture into shells & place on baking sheet. Bake @ 350º for 10 minutes or until hot. WW Points per potato: 2
